Kayla Whaley is a novelist and essayist. She's an editor at Disability in Kidlit and a graduate of the Clarion Writers’ Workshop. Her work has appeared in Uncanny Magazine, The Toast, The Establishment, and is forthcoming in Kelly Jensen’s young adult anthology Feminism for the Real World. She lives outside Atlanta with too many books and not nearly enough cats, but can most often be found being overly sincere on the internet.
